1996-12-08: Beech B36TC (N3000R) — Thomas T. Laughlin — Jackson, WY

Jackson, WY, US

On December 8, 1996, a Beech B36TC (registration N3000R) operated by Thomas T. Laughlin was involved in an aviation accident near Jackson, WY. Investigators recorded the probable cause as: failure of the pilot to follow IFR procedures. High terrain, low ceiling, icing conditions, and a possible anomaly with the VOR were related factors. After obtaining weather information including forecast icing and low ceiling, a pilot on a VOR/DME approach to Jackson, Wyoming, failed to execute a required turn at the 16 DME arc. The aircraft impacted terrain near a 10,741-foot peak.

Incident Overview

A pilot flying an aircraft under visual flight rules (VFR) contacted Flight Watch after takeoff and obtained weather information. The briefing included forecast icing conditions and a low ceiling at the destination airport in Jackson, Wyoming. The pilot was subsequently cleared to proceed via Victor 238 airway.

Approach and Navigation

During the arrival, air traffic control cleared the pilot for a VOR/DME approach to runway 36. Radar data indicated that while en route, the aircraft was not tracking the center of the airway, but was positioned a few miles to the right. The controller informed the pilot of this deviation, and the pilot responded that his VOR receiver was "kind of in and out." The pilot's last transmission to the controller, before being cleared for the approach, stated that he was picking up moderate rime ice.

Missed Turn and Impact

At the 16 DME arc, the flight did not execute the required turn to the west onto the arc. Instead, it continued to parallel the airway. Shortly thereafter, radar contact was lost. The aircraft subsequently impacted terrain near the top of a 10,741-foot peak, located approximately 11 miles southeast of the airport. The minimum altitude for the approach was 12,700 feet on the arc until passing west of the 165-degree radial, then 11,500 feet until inbound on the 186-degree radial.

Postcrash Examination

Evidence at the accident site indicated that after impact, an avalanche started, and the aircraft slid downhill about 300 feet before coming to rest partially buried in snow. Postcrash examination of the wreckage did not reveal evidence of a mechanical failure or malfunction.
